Output 656a2e4c587c93d53af3174c506c0ee3a785dfe803e1f7ce948045078c83ec5b:9

value
448652096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f66ae8311193ae36af740eb564b60ac3cc7be84 OP_EQUAL
address
MAmCBpqjYdfRGGTjc7qSC48fMHJnEB22eJ
transaction
656a2e4c587c93d53af3174c506c0ee3a785dfe803e1f7ce948045078c83ec5b
spent
true